Brief specs of 2007 Mercedes-Benz SL 65 AMG Roadster

2-door 2-seater convertible (cabriolet), petrol (gasoline) engine, DOHC (double overhead camshafts, twin cam), 5980 cm3 / 364.9 cu in / 364.9 cu in, 460.0 kW / 616.9 hp / 616.9 hp @ 4800 rpm / 4800 rpm / 4800 rpm, 500.0 N·m / 368.8 lb·ft / 368.8 lb·ft @ 1500 rpm / 1500 rpm / 1500 rpm, automatic 5-speed transmission, rear wheel drive, 295 km/h / 183 mph / 183 mph top speed, consumption 18.6 l/100km / 15.2 mpg-UK / 12.6 mpg-US

Tips and tricks for lowering car insurance costs in Great Britain

If you’re trying to finesse the lowest price of car insurance in Great Britain, there are a few things to watch out for. Car insurance marketing is clever. Its aim is to make you feel you’re getting the best deal but to maximise the insurer’s profit at the same time.

Get a ‘new’ quote from your existing insurer

Often applying to your existing insurer as a new customer produces a cheaper price than its renewal quote. Insurers put out more competitive prices to attract new customers so simply start again and you could be better off.
